Why Blue-Green Paint Colors Work Well in Dark Rooms
While bright whites and pale neutrals are often recommended for dark spaces, sometimes these shades can feel harsh and cold rather than fresh and light. This is where blue-green paint colors come in.
Ranging from muted aquas to deep jewel tones, blue-greens walk the line between energizing and soothing. They add vibrancy and brightness without being overpowering in a space that lacks natural light.
These cooler paint colors also create a tranquil atmosphere, helping balance out the cozy warmth of a darker room. The psychology of color tells us that we perceive blue and green as peaceful and relaxing shades.

Unlike stark whites, blue-greens with warm gray, green or taupe undertones complement the dimmer, yellow-tinged artificial lighting often used in dark rooms. Their versatility allows them to make a subtle impact or dramatic statement.
Factors to Consider When Choosing Paint Colors
Keep these factors in mind when selecting a blue-green paint for a low-lit space:
- Room Orientation - North-facing rooms need warmer hues than south-facing
- Natural vs. Artificial Lighting - Cool fluorescents vs. warm bulbs impact color
- Room Use - Bedrooms benefit from more soothing shades

Avoiding Common Mistakes
When working with a darker room, avoid:
- True whites that can feel harsh and cold
- Forgetting to test colors at different times of day
- Colors with undertones that clash with room features
A few extra pointers for bringing light to a dark space:
- Use bright white paint on the ceilings to reflect light
- Add stylish accent walls in brighter hues
- Incorporate multiple lamps at varying heights
